    Senior HR Practitioner - Makhanda

    Main Objectives
    As the line manager of the relevant unit, the Senior HR Practitioner and the unit team are required to offer a professional and valued HR service to the relevant Faculties and/or Divisions. Within the Recruitment and Staffing Section, the individual is also expected to contribute to developing best practices, policies, and processes that enable and drive increased long-term efficiency and effectiveness of staff within the relevant Faculties/Divisions. 

    The HR Officer and the Senior HR Practitioner will operate in a unit. These units are in the Recruitment and Staffing Section. The Recruitment and Staffing section is within the P&C Division.

    The Requirements
    A relevant B. Degree (preferably in Industrial/Organisational Psychology or Human Resources) plus approximately 6 years’ relevant experience where such experience includes: -

    • A minimum of 4 years’ previous experience as an HR Practitioner, where recruitment and HR Admin are key responsibilities;
    • Experience where HR work has been executed with the use of an HR information technology system;
    • Experience in most, if not all, areas of HR (for example, Recruitment and Selection, HR Administration, Industrial Relations, Training and Development, Remuneration, Performance Management, HR IT systems, and Well-being);
    • At least one year’s management experience;
    • Assisting with the development of structures, systems, and processes to ensure service delivery of a high quality that is valued by others;
    • At least 24 months of experience in a pressurised, complex, and high-volume people management environment, dealing with a large staff complement (minimum of 500 employees);
    • Previous experience within the Higher Education sector will be an advantage.
